Cuban Cuisine: The Heart and Soul of Miami Food
Let's start with the obvious: Cuban food is everywhere in Miami. And for good reason. It's a symphony of flavors that will make your taste buds do a happy dance. The Cuban sandwich is the undisputed king, a masterpiece of ham, pork, Swiss cheese, pickles, and mustard pressed between two slices of Cuban bread. But don't stop there! Explore the world of ropa vieja (shredded beef), croquetas (deep-fried goodness), and medianoche (midnight sandwich, perfect for a late-night snack).

Seafood Sensation: Straight from the Ocean to Your Plate
Miami is surrounded by water, so it's no surprise that seafood is a big deal. Stone crabs are the undisputed champions, but don't overlook the delicious grouper, snapper, and mahi-mahi. If you're feeling adventurous, try conch fritters or ceviche. And let's not forget about the Key West pink shrimp - tiny but mighty!

A Flavorful Fusion: Latin American Delights
Miami is a melting pot of Latin American cultures, and the food scene reflects that. You'll find everything from spicy Colombian arepas to rich Venezuelan teque�os. Don't miss out on the opportunity to try authentic Mexican tacos, Dominican sancocho, or Peruvian ceviche. Your taste buds will thank you.

Sweet Endings: Key Lime Pie and More
No Miami food adventure is complete without a sweet ending. Key lime pie is the iconic choice, with its tangy, creamy perfection. But there's more to life than Key lime pie (although it's pretty hard to beat). Explore the world of flan, dulce de leche, and guava pastries. Your sweet tooth will be in overdrive.
